We chose to volunteer in Vietnam because, although its healthcare is improving in comparison to other South East Asian countries, this country still faces some crucial issues such as infant malnutrition, poverty and the impossibility to access clean water in many rural areas.
During the volunteering program - with the organisation IVI (Involvement Volunteers International) - we will be working in a local government operated hospital in Ho Chi Minh, serving various communities within the city. We will be assisting the local staff in a range of different departments, according to where we are going to be needed the most and to where we feel more comfortable working. The hospital offers various departments including, amongst others, a children’s ward, an operating theatre and an emergency room.
